In the United States, cars and truck dealers have traditionally been an essential resource of state and neighborhood sales tax obligations. They have considerable political impact and have lobbied for laws that ensure their survival and productivity. By 2010, all US states had laws that banned makers from side-stepping independent cars and truck dealerships and selling cars directly to consumers.Today, straight sales by an automaker to consumers are restricted by the majority of states in the U.S. via franchise laws that require new cars and trucks to be offered only by certified and bound, individually owned dealers. The very first lady cars and truck dealership in the United States was Rachel "Mommy" Krouse that in 1903 opened her useful site business, Krouse Motor Automobile Company, in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.

Audi has actually explore a hi-tech showroom that enables consumers to set up and experience cars and trucks on 1:1 scale digital screens. In markets where it is permitted, Mercedes-Benz opened city centre brand name shops. Tesla Motors has actually declined the dealer sales model based upon the idea that car dealerships do not appropriately clarify the benefits of their vehicles, and they might not rely on third-party car dealerships to manage their sales.
The franchisor can act opportunistically by imposing constraints and burden on the franchisee after the last has actually incurred sunk prices, such as investing in physical assets and developing a credibility with customers. The franchisor could as an example call for that cars and trucks be sold at low cost, and solutions be carried out for little payment.

Auto dealers have actually lobbied for guidelines that increase the survival and earnings of vehicle dealers: By 2010, all US states had regulations that restricted suppliers from side-stepping independent automobile suppliers and selling cars and trucks to consumers straight. By 2009, many states enforced restrictions on the creation of new car dealerships to contend with incumbent dealerships.Most states stop manufacturers from taking part in "amount requiring" wherein manufacturers need that dealerships acquisition cars that they had actually not gotten. Many states restrict the ability of producers to discriminate in between automobile dealers (for example, by supplying much better terms to huge auto suppliers with economic climates of scale or dealers that offer far better customer service).
